Transaction 66e15258d6fc5300ced8fc2d36c1b8c9d12baed0d1f278d80e6377b7c423b721
1 Input
2 Outputs
- 66e15258d6fc5300ced8fc2d36c1b8c9d12baed0d1f278d80e6377b7c423b721:0
- 66e15258d6fc5300ced8fc2d36c1b8c9d12baed0d1f278d80e6377b7c423b721:1
value 60000000
address 3FuN5EG56YdBGKeJ36D54pr5vpYth6dvVR
value 119999049
address 1JFmH65BschWZVPUyYtEYWMsCwTE8BPmVy